Overview of Nylon Spatulas

Nylon spatulas are versatile kitchen tools widely recognized for their practicality and functionality. Made from high-quality nylon, these spatulas are designed to withstand high temperatures, making them ideal for use with a variety of cookware, including non-stick surfaces. Their heat resistance allows them to handle cooking tasks without the risk of melting or deforming, which is a common drawback with plastic spatulas. As a result, they are favored by both home cooks and professional chefs alike.

One of the standout features of nylon spatulas is their flexibility. This attribute allows users to easily maneuver the spatula under foods, making flipping pancakes, turning burgers, and serving delicate items like fish a breeze. The thin edges of nylon spatulas slide seamlessly beneath food, minimizing the risk of breaking or damaging even the most fragile dishes. Additionally, their non-abrasive surface ensures that cookware remains scratch-free, extending the lifespan of your kitchen essentials.

Another advantage of nylon spatulas is their lightweight design, which makes them comfortable to handle during prolonged cooking sessions. They come in various shapes and sizes, catering to different culinary tasks and preferences. From slotted spatulas for draining excess liquids to solid spatulas perfect for lifting and serving, the best nylon spatulas offer a tool for virtually every cooking need. Moreover, they are often available in vibrant colors, adding a touch of flair to the kitchen.

Cleaning nylon spatulas is typically hassle-free, as most are dishwasher safe, and those that are not can easily be washed by hand. This ease of maintenance is particularly appealing to busy households where time-saving kitchen tools are a must. Advantages of Using Nylon Spatulas

Nylon spatulas offer a range of advantages that make them a popular choice in kitchens worldwide. One of their most significant benefits is their non-scratch property, which allows them to glide smoothly over non-stick cookware without causing damage. Unlike metal spatulas, which can create scratches leading to the peeling of non-stick coatings, nylon spatulas maintain the integrity of your pans, ensuring they last longer.

Another critical advantage is their heat resistance. Many nylon spatulas can withstand high temperatures, typically up to 400°F (204°C), making them suitable for a variety of cooking methods, including sautéing and stir-frying. This characteristic allows cooks to use them in a wide range of culinary tasks without the fear of the utensil melting or warping, unlike some plastic or rubber spatulas.

Furthermore, nylon spatulas are lightweight and comfortable to handle. Their ergonomic design often includes a soft grip, which makes them less straining to use during extended cooking sessions. This feature is particularly valuable for home cooks who enjoy spending time in the kitchen, as it enhances the overall cooking experience and helps to prevent fatigue.

Care and Maintenance of Nylon Spatulas

To ensure longevity and optimal performance of your nylon spatulas, proper care and maintenance are essential. Most nylon spatulas are dishwasher-safe, which makes cleaning them a breeze. However, to preserve their condition, it is recommended to wash them by hand using warm, soapy water. This practice helps prevent any potential wear from the harsh conditions of a dishwasher.

It’s also important to avoid using abrasive cleaners or scouring pads when washing nylon spatulas, as these can scratch the surface and diminish their effectiveness. Instead, opt for soft sponges or cloths that won’t compromise the material. Furthermore, it’s wise to avoid using your nylon spatulas with very high heat settings, as excessive heat can lead to discoloration or warping over time.

Storing nylon spatulas properly is another key aspect of maintenance. For best results, keep them in a drawer or utensil holder where they won’t rub against sharp objects, which could cause nicks and scratches. Alternatively, hanging them on a rack not only keeps the spatulas easily accessible but also helps to maintain their shape and condition.

Different Types of Nylon Spatulas

There is a wide variety of nylon spatulas available on the market, each designed for specific tasks and cooking styles. One common type is the slotted spatula, which features cutouts to allow for excess liquid to drain off. This design is particularly useful for flipping items like pancakes or eggs, where you want to maintain the fluffy texture while letting excess fat or moisture escape.

Another popular type is the solid spatula, which is ideal for lifting and serving delicate foods such as fish fillets or baked goods without breaking them apart. The solid design offers a sturdy surface for turning and maneuvering, making it an essential tool for anyone who enjoys baking or sautéing.

For those who engage in grilling or barbecuing, a spatula with a longer handle may be preferable. These spatulas are designed to keep you at a safe distance from flames while still allowing for flipping and serving. Additionally, some nylon spatulas now come with integrated features such as bottle openers or measuring tools, adding to their versatility and making them even more appealing to modern cooks.

6. Are there any downsides to using nylon spatulas?

While nylon spatulas are beneficial in many ways, there are some downsides to consider. One significant concern is their heat resistance limit. If exposed to high temperatures beyond their rated levels, they can warp or melt, resulting in potential damage and even contamination of food if plastic pieces break off.

Additionally, nylon spatulas may not be as sturdy as their metal counterparts, which can affect their effectiveness for heavy lifting or scraping hard surfaces. Over time, they may also become discolored or retain odors from certain foods, so periodic replacement might be necessary to maintain their appearance and functionality.
